Practical synthesis of 2,5-disubstituted 1,3-dioxolane-4-ones and highly diastereoselective cis-2,5-disubstituted 1,3-dioxolane-4-ones from α-hydroxy acids catalyzed by N-triflylphosphoramide
摘要:
N-triflylphosphoramide (NTPA) was found to be an efficient Bronsted acid catalyst for the practical synthesis of 2,5-disubstituted 1,3-dioxolane-4-ones. Racemic and optically pure mandelic acid and lactic acid could be protected using several aldehydes in high selectivity and moderate yield in the presence of NTPA without azeotropic distillation or use of a dehydrating reagent. A new highly diastereoselective synthesis of 2,5-disubstituted-1,3-dioxolan-4-ones from α-hydroxyacids

Reaction of α-hydroxyacids with acetals under weak acid catalysis gave the corresponding dioxolanones with a better diastereomeric ratio than the usual strong acid catalyzed synthesisfrom aldehydes.
